Sitting to the west of this stunning Balearic island, the town of Ciudadela de Menorca is waiting for you to discover it.A heady mix of colonial splendour and portside glamour, Ciudadela is known simply in Catalan as Vella I Bella, which translates to ‘old and beautiful’. Living up to its fabled reputation, the town’s main square, Plaça d’es Born is a grandiose sight, lined with the stately buildings of Palau Torresaura and the town hall. For breathtaking views, climbing the 14th-century Bastió d’Es Governador that overlooks the town never fails to impress.
The town’s old quarter, the maze of cobbled streets between Plaça de ses Palmeres and Plaça d’es Born, overflows with charm. The ornately baroque Església del Roser (Church of the Rosary) dates back to the 17th century and nearby Carrer ses Voltes boasts boutique shops, exceptional restaurants and lively bars.
Head down to the harbour to find upmarket eateries and sophisticated cafes that line the water’s edge. Evenings are best spent strolling along the yacht-lined waterfront, soaking up the atmosphere.

Beyond Ciudadela de Menorca
The most peaceful and serene of the Balearic Islands, Menorca has so much to offer. With sun-bleached sands and rolling hills, the best way to see the beauty of Menorca is to drive.Mahón
The island’s other major town, Mahón is a 45-minute drive east across the island on the Me-1 from Ciuadadela de Menorca. Sitting atop the world’s second longest natural harbour, the town of Mahón is a unique blend of British and Spanish heritage, boasting distinctly Georgian architecture and British tradition. With stunning scenery and an easy-going vibe, this charming clifftop town is the ultimate road trip experience.
Parc Natural S’Albufera d’es Grau
A peaceful freshwater lagoon protected from development, Parc Natural S’Albufera d’es Grau is the stunning home to an impressive array of wildlife, from herons and lizards to tortoises and eagles. Just under an hour and a half from Ciudadela de Menorca, this beautiful park is a sight to behold and well worth exploring.
Beaches of Menorca
Menorca is most famed for its unspoilt, sandy Mediterranean beaches. From the show-stopping coves of Cala Galdana to the watersports’ paradise of Son Bou, on the southern side of the island, you’ll be able to find your ideal beach to relax and unwind on. Both of these spots are under 45 minutes from Ciudadela de Menorca by car.
